French-bulldog
noun
1.
one of a French breed of small, bat-eared dogs having a large, square head, a short tail, and a short, sleek coat.
noun
1.
a small stocky breed of dog with a sleek coat, usually brindled or pied, a large square head, and large erect rounded ears
